SENT WARNING; Erik Paske believes his APR team will only get better, and has warned his rivals ahead of the new season.

ERIK Paske has warned APR’s rivals to expect more from the army side this season.

The Dutch coach sounded the warning after his team’s commanding 4-1 victory over SC Kiyovu in Thursday’s Pre-season tournament final.

"We played good football and I hope we can progress to play even better. If they [players] can progress, then this side will be stronger than today [Thursday],”

"We need to enhance the player’s endurance and physical fitness ahead of the start of the season and hope for the best in the upcoming season.

"It’s too early to predict the African Champions’ league with this squad but I am hoping for the best,” Paske said.

New signing Abbas Rassou scored a hat trick while Leon Xavier Cedric put the icing on the cake with a fourth goal as the defending league champions ran amok at a fairly packed Amahoro Stadium.

On top of domestic tournaments, APR have their eyes at reaching the group stages of the Caf Champions League- Africa’s premier club championship.

The team lifted their tenth league title after a 2-0 victory over Mukura on the final day of the league.
The new season kicks off October 17.
